Output ef8cc89d731e66efd6b18f073a326bb5c4d0c2b264f572ba1f1cd577b9f6c1f6:87

value
69625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41a2f9cfbb29aabeb369d0383637c30e7c4c8781 OP_EQUAL
address
37g55mi3cxceXdvAFPbY9wptVBidwpM8H8
transaction
ef8cc89d731e66efd6b18f073a326bb5c4d0c2b264f572ba1f1cd577b9f6c1f6
spent
true